Jetstar unveiled as official airline of Asia’s Got Talent

27 Jan 2015  2066 | Business & Trade Fairs

SINGAPORE - Jetstar is pleased to announce sponsorship of the very first season of the wildly popular talent competition – Asia’s Got Talent.

The first pan-regional format of the talent search programme will see some of the region’s most aspiring artistes gather in Singapore to fight for the coveted winning title.

Jetstar’s network of 22 destinations across 13 countries in Asia Pacific will enable the region’s top talents to fly further to fulfill their dreams and aspirations.

“The talent show has proven to be very popular around the world and we are proud and excited to be the official airline for the first ever Asian edition,” said Barathan Pasupathi, CEO of Jetstar Asia.

“It is indeed a treat to be able to bring the best of Asia's talent together for the regional auditions and live performances in Singapore, following open auditions in Taipei, Jakarta and Manila -- all major cities we fly to. Our low fares also make it more accessible for the participants' families and friends to take off and support them," added Mr Pasupathi.

To support these artistes in their pursuit of being Asia’s top talent, Jetstar will provide complimentary return airfares to those who are shortlisted from across Asia for the judges’ auditions up until the grand finale, which will be held in Singapore.

Each contestant may also invite a companion to support them in reaching for the stars.

"Asia’s Got Talent is the widest reaching version of the already world record breaking Got Talent format. We’re proud to partner with Jetstar to bring these phenomenal performances to all of Asia, thereby bringing even more countries into the Got Talent family,” said Paul O’Hanlon, managing director of Fremantle Media Asia.

To celebrate the season premiere of Asia’s Got Talent, a Jetstar A320 will now sport a brand new look.

“The livery is a first in Got Talent history, and it is the perfect embodiment of Asia’s Got Talent’s goal of finding the best talents from across the continent and bringing them together in the world’s largest, widest reaching talent competition,” added Mr O’Hanlon.

The aircraft will take to the skies from February and will fly around the region to destinations in the Jetstar network for the next six months.
